You are booking hotel for more than 30 days
Rieti, Rieti
Rieti City Center
Rieti
Rieti
Rieti
Rieti
Rieti
Rieti
Rieti
Rieti City Center
Rieti City Center
Rieti City Center
Rieti
Rieti
Rieti City Center
Rieti
Rieti
Rieti
Rieti
Siena City Center
Rome City Centre
Poggibonsi
Siena City Center
Rome City Centre
Siena City Center
Valmontone
Chianciano Terme
Siena City Center
Le Scotte